What is "wrongful death"?

People are not immortal. When we are children we learn that death is a fact of life: we all go sometime. The most fortunate live a long life and pass away comfortably surrounded by family, but often lives are taken seemingly before their time, from disease, fatal accidents, or violence. In most cases, however tragic, a death is simply a loss to be grieved, a life to be remembered.

But what if your parent, spouse, or child was killed as a result of the recklessness, negligence, or intentional harm of another person, an institution, or a business?

This is what we call wrongful death. All loss of life feels wrong, of course, but there are two clear conditions for wrongful death:

  • That the victim died as a result of the action-or inaction-of someone else. In other words, that someone is at fault.
  • That the victim would not have died if this action-or inaction-had not taken place.

When a death is caused by recklessness, negligence, or intentional harm, the surviving family has a legal right to compensation for their loss.

  • Can I sue a hospital if I contract MRSA while in the hospital?   
    Over the last few months I have received many phone calls and emails from people who have contracted MRSA while staying in the hospital for routine surgeries, etc. They all ask me the same question: Can I sue the hospital because I contracted MRSA while staying at the hospital? I say yes you can sue, but you don’t automatically win just because you contracted MRSA. You have to show that the hospital did something wrong and that negligence led to you contracting MRSA or not being treated effectively. This area of litigation is complicated and cases can be difficult and costly to win.   • Shocking Statistics on Mini Blind-Related Deaths Discussed by Ohio Wrongful Death Attorney   
    Tragically, few consumers realize that their preference in window coverings can lead to the death of their children or children visiting their home and/or place of business. According to an article in the June 1997 issue of the Journal of the American Medical Association, 359 children were strangled by mini blind cords between 1981 and 1995. Even more tragic is the fact that over 93 percent of the victims were toddlers or infants. At a rate of approximately one incident per two weeks, mini blind strangulation is a very serious risk but it also comes with a unique set of legal problems to deal with.   • MRSA Infections: Be Informed Before a Minor Scrape Becomes a Life-Threatening Infection   
    With respect to car accidents in Ohio, any competent Ohio car accident lawyer will tell you that contracting MRSA while being treated for accident related injuries becomes part of your car accident lawsuit damages. The party who caused the accident is liable for all damages reasonably foreseeable from his negligence. Contracting MRSA from accident related treatment or injuries is arguably foreseeable and the at-fault driver should pay these medical bills and pain and suffering surrounding these MRSA related injuries. If a person dies from MRSA contracted from injuries or treatment from the accident, then the car accident claim becomes a wrongful death claim.
